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62308 05264304416 611465 7072 643362
837 42782576666 583094
837 42782576666 583094
6061 5590 410 65088484
All about undefined
Interested in learning more?
837 42782576666 583094
6061 5590 410 65088484
See more
4589246342 614 3997
15315 4630512146 4355743830 478124
See more
65 014653
5675490 551 59369054 90945
See more